What is Medicaid Planning?


Medicaid planning is the creation and implementation of an asset protection plan within the confines of federal and state law. Through this planning, we are able to protect assets and provide for a smooth transition into full Medicaid eligibility whether it be homecare, assisted living or skilled nursing. There are several exemptions in Medicaid law that, when used properly, will yield eligibility even if assets are gifted within the five-year lookback period. Should you not qualify for one of the Medicaid exemptions, we are still able to utilize spend-down techniques, gifting plans and other strategies to protect your assets irrespective of the amount of assets you possess.

Whether your loved one is contemplating nursing home placement or has already been placed, or even if gifts have been made within the five-year lookback period, we can create a plan to address these issues and meet your needs.

Some of the Medicaid Planning services we offer at Ward Arcuri Foley & Dwyer are:

  • Medicaid qualification for homecare, assisted living and nursing home placement. The need for any of these services, through the implementation of a proper plan, can be paid for by the Medicaid system. We can accomplish the same whether it be after planning has already been implemented or in the case of a crisis or an emergency need.

  • Addressing Medicaid denials, Medicaid penalties and Medicaid fair hearings.

  • Asset protection strategies to prevent against spending down one’s assets. Through these plans a significant portion of your liquid assets and real property can be protected.

  • Arranging for PRI’s, which is a screening tool for your loved one used to determine their level of care so that they are safely placed in the appropriate environment (homecare, assisted living or skilled nursing).
